"Storyboard" is a bit of a misnomer here: what Mizukami drew were the rough drafts ("names" if you know mangaka lingo) for the manga and the animation studio just repurposed them as storyboards, skipping the usual steps of having someone turn the source material into a screenplay and then creating the storyboards from that. So if it seems like a shot-for-shot adaptation of the manga, it's because that's what they're quite literally doing The biggest divergence so far that I've noticed are the backgrounds, which makes sense since those are usually mostly absent at the draft stage. Take the scene in ep 2/ch 3 where Souya runs into Torai, for example: in the manga it's set in your standard park in the middle of the city, while in the anime it's on some kind of seaside jogging path next to a forest. (Also, Mizukami drew the drafts in about 1 year, not 4)
